// SPDX-License-Identifier: GPL-2.0
|
|
/*
|
|
* Copyright (C) 2020, Google LLC.
|
|
*
|
|
* Test that KVM emulates instructions in response to EPT violations when
|
|
* allow_smaller_maxphyaddr is enabled and guest.MAXPHYADDR < host.MAXPHYADDR.
|
|
*/
|
|
#include "flds_emulation.h"
|
|
|
|
#include "test_util.h"
|
|
#include "kvm_util.h"
|
|
#include "vmx.h"
|
|
|
|
#define MAXPHYADDR 36
|
|
|
|
#define MEM_REGION_GVA 0x0000123456789000
|
|
#define MEM_REGION_GPA 0x0000000700000000
|
|
#define MEM_REGION_SLOT 10
|
|
#define MEM_REGION_SIZE PAGE_SIZE
|
|
|
|
static void guest_code(bool tdp_enabled)
|
|
{
|
|
uint64_t error_code;
|
|
uint64_t vector;
|
|
|
|
vector = kvm_asm_safe_ec(FLDS_MEM_EAX, error_code, "a"(MEM_REGION_GVA));
|
|
|
|
/*
|
|
* When TDP is enabled, flds will trigger an emulation failure, exit to
|
|
* userspace, and then the selftest host "VMM" skips the instruction.
|
|
*
|
|
* When TDP is disabled, no instruction emulation is required so flds
|
|
* should generate #PF(RSVD).
|
|
*/
|
|
if (tdp_enabled) {
|
|
GUEST_ASSERT(!vector);
|
|
} else {
|
|
GUEST_ASSERT_EQ(vector, PF_VECTOR);
|
|
GUEST_ASSERT(error_code & PFERR_RSVD_MASK);
|
|
}
|
|
|
|
GUEST_DONE();
|
|
}
|
|
|
|
int main(int argc, char *argv[])
|
|
{
|
|
struct kvm_vcpu *vcpu;
|
|
struct kvm_vm *vm;
|
|
struct ucall uc;
|
|
uint64_t *pte;
|
|
uint64_t *hva;
|
|
uint64_t gpa;
|
|
int rc;
|
|
|
|
TEST_REQUIRE(kvm_has_cap(KVM_CAP_SMALLER_MAXPHYADDR));
|
|
|
|
vm = vm_create_with_one_vcpu(&vcpu, guest_code);
|
|
vcpu_args_set(vcpu, 1, kvm_is_tdp_enabled());
|
|
|
|
vcpu_set_cpuid_property(vcpu, X86_PROPERTY_MAX_PHY_ADDR, MAXPHYADDR);
|
|
|
|
rc = kvm_check_cap(KVM_CAP_EXIT_ON_EMULATION_FAILURE);
|
|
TEST_ASSERT(rc, "KVM_CAP_EXIT_ON_EMULATION_FAILURE is unavailable");
|
|
vm_enable_cap(vm, KVM_CAP_EXIT_ON_EMULATION_FAILURE, 1);
|
|
|
|
vm_userspace_mem_region_add(vm, VM_MEM_SRC_ANONYMOUS,
|
|
MEM_REGION_GPA, MEM_REGION_SLOT,
|
|
MEM_REGION_SIZE / PAGE_SIZE, 0);
|
|
gpa = vm_phy_pages_alloc(vm, MEM_REGION_SIZE / PAGE_SIZE,
|
|
MEM_REGION_GPA, MEM_REGION_SLOT);
|
|
TEST_ASSERT(gpa == MEM_REGION_GPA, "Failed vm_phy_pages_alloc");
|
|
virt_map(vm, MEM_REGION_GVA, MEM_REGION_GPA, 1);
|
|
hva = addr_gpa2hva(vm, MEM_REGION_GPA);
|
|
memset(hva, 0, PAGE_SIZE);
|
|
|
|
pte = vm_get_page_table_entry(vm, MEM_REGION_GVA);
|
|
*pte |= BIT_ULL(MAXPHYADDR);
|
|
|
|
vcpu_run(vcpu);
|
|
|
|
/*
|
|
* When TDP is enabled, KVM must emulate in response the guest physical
|
|
* address that is illegal from the guest's perspective, but is legal
|
|
* from hardware's perspeective. This should result in an emulation
|
|
* failure exit to userspace since KVM doesn't support emulating flds.
|
|
*/
|
|
if (kvm_is_tdp_enabled()) {
|
|
handle_flds_emulation_failure_exit(vcpu);
|
|
vcpu_run(vcpu);
|
|
}
|
|
|
|
switch (get_ucall(vcpu, &uc)) {
|
|
case UCALL_ABORT:
|
|
REPORT_GUEST_ASSERT(uc);
|
|
break;
|
|
case UCALL_DONE:
|
|
break;
|
|
default:
|
|
TEST_FAIL("Unrecognized ucall: %lu", uc.cmd);
|
|
}
|
|
|
|
kvm_vm_free(vm);
|
|
|
|
return 0;
|
|
}
